Podium finishes at Tramore Duathlon
There seems to be no stopping Martin Kirwan at the moment as he stormed through the field of athletes today to triumph at the Duathlon in Tramore. He had a tough job ahead of him heading out onto the 2nd run as he was about 200m behind the leader Kevin Shelly but he dug deep and overtook him over half way round the course to finish 1st overall. Davin Power was next clubmember home (I think 5th?) with Stefan, Michael Moloney and Stephen Doyle next home for the club (I don't have any places or times yet as results not up yet)
Siobhan Dunphy also had a podium finish to finish 3rd female overall with Jenny Kervick collecting a prize for 1st female over 40 (hope she doesn't mind me giving away her age....)
Well done to everyone, there were almost 25 members taking part today
